And what advice do you have to make first semester easier and/or less of a "shock"? Heard fundamentals is a beast of a class

I found out offically by letter on July 13, but there's a little trick! Periodically check your degree audit on Cunyfirst .. If your accepted your major will usually change a few days before you receive the letter ( it would say NUR AAS). The biggest thing I told people is to stay on top of studying, don't leave it to last minute! Testing is a whole new style, the questions are critical thinking analysis questions not recall so memorizing info will do you no good (except for lab values and some other things). It would be in your best interest to buy books with practice questions like fundamentals success or fundamentals reviews and rationales to get used to the testing style.
